Vendor note: the tile-rendering cache layer for Mapglass is hosted by Quillstone Systems under our standard SLA. If cache hit rates drop below 85% or eviction storms appear in the Mapglass dashboard, Quillstone handles tier-one triage; we only intervene for config pushes. Their support desk responds within two hours during business days. Reach their on-call rotation at the address below.

escalation mailbox, hadug-bajog: sormir@norvalabs.internal

- [ ] Canteen access: the Drayman's Court canteen is shared with Osterly Metrics next door. Take new starters via the link bridge on Level 1. Osterly staff use the far tills; ours use the near ones. Entry to the bridge door needs the pass code below.

staff pass of kawip-hawef = bdg-QLP-2

**Ticket WS-771: Reconnect storm traced to config drift**

So the Pylon websocket gateway has been reconnect-storming every night around log rotation, and it turns out half the fleet is running last quarter's backoff settings. Someone hand-patched three boxes during the Octave incident and never committed it, so reconnect jitter is basically off on those nodes and clients all slam back at once. If you get paged tonight, restart the drifted nodes first — don't touch the healthy ones. The intended settings are below.

config for kafof-bawef:
holath:
  log_level: debug
  metrics_host: metrics.holath.qorvelsys.internal
  pin: 2191
  pool_size: 32

## Profile Store Sharding

Vellum Profiles shards user records across twelve partitions by account hash. Resharding runs via the Driftgate admin API; the release manager triggers it after each capacity review. All reshard calls must be authenticated against Driftgate's internal control plane. Pass the key below in the auth header for every reshard request.

gateway credential: kto23_LX9A4ys6i4nzHtpOLNLodKK